Output 81558d8aa87496bf1dc8c0393c8d201d4b620e41ce8ebdbdefa2e39d570b31f6:1

value
2703283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32cea5c4b93c93e4a6e47d8c5dad328b95550af OP_EQUAL
address
3J2QgfQfD3rKx5r73Jv6vx3tCDVvojXdA6
transaction
81558d8aa87496bf1dc8c0393c8d201d4b620e41ce8ebdbdefa2e39d570b31f6
spent
true